Re: [ferret_users] how to map date strings from a csv file onto a ferret time axis



Hi Al,

In general, you can read date/ time information from a text file with  "set data/form=delimited" 

https://ferret.pmel.noaa.gov/Ferret/documentation/users-guide/commands-reference/SET#_VPINDEXENTRY_1612
https://ferret.pmel.noaa.gov/Ferret/documentation/users-guide/data-set-basics/ASCII-DATA#Chapter2-delimited_files

It looks like what's in your file corresponds to the "datime" format, but you would need to edit the file to replace the T with a space, and remove the Z.  Also, if the file has quotation marks around the dates, remove those.

It should go something like this:

  yes? file/form=delim/var="ftime"/type="datime" myfile.csv

  ! Look at the time data and its units. Dates are translated into "days since 1900,
  ! and time is added as a fraction of the day

   list/i=1:10/precision=8 ftime 
   define axis/t/t0=1=jan=1900/units=days my_time_axis = ftime

Does anyone know how to easily map dates like the ones shown below (contained as a variable in a csv file) onto a time axis in ferret? The file contains one date string and temperature value (plus other variables) per line. So far I have not found any ferret function that can interpret these strings - does one exist? Thanks.
-Al Hermann


yes? list/i=1:10 time
             VARIABLE : TIME
             FILENAME : 2021_SpringDeployed_BS_BioPUFFS_POPS0001_bottomdata.csv
             SUBSET   : 10 points (X)
 1    /  1:"2021-05-13T00:10:00Z"
 2    /  2:"2021-05-13T01:10:00Z"
 3    /  3:"2021-05-13T02:10:00Z"
 4    /  4:"2021-05-13T03:10:00Z"
 5    /  5:"2021-05-13T04:10:00Z"
 6    /  6:"2021-05-13T05:10:00Z"
 7    /  7:"2021-05-13T06:10:00Z"
 8    /  8:"2021-05-13T07:10:00Z"
 9    /  9:"2021-05-13T08:10:00Z"
 10   / 10:"2021-05-13T09:10:00Z"
